web前端管理系统项目怎么做
-
要开发一个Web前端管理系统项目,首先需要明确项目的需求和目标,然后按照以下步骤进行开发:
-
需求分析:与项目相关的各方(如客户、团队成员)进行沟通,了解他们的需求和期望。根据需求分析,将功能和模块进行划分,并进行优先级排序。
-
技术选型:根据项目的需求和目标,选择适合的技术栈。常用的前端技术包括HTML、CSS、JavaScript,以及一些流行的前端框架和库,如React、Angular、Vue等。
-
界面设计:根据需求分析和用户体验设计,设计系统的界面布局和交互方式。可以使用工具软件(如Sketch、Figma等)进行设计,并与团队成员进行讨论和修改。
-
前端开发:根据界面设计和需求分析,采用选择的技术栈进行前端代码的编写。可以使用开发工具(如VS Code、Sublime Text等)进行开发,使用版本控制工具(如Git)进行代码管理。
-
后端开发:如果系统需要与后端进行交互,需要进行后端开发。后端开发可以使用各种编程语言和框架,如Java、Python、Node.js等。后端开发主要负责数据的处理和存储,以及与前端的接口对接。
-
数据库设计:根据系统需求,设计和建立相应的数据库。选择适合的数据库软件,如MySQL、Oracle等,进行数据表的设计和创建。后端开发和数据库设计需要密切合作。
-
系统集成:将前端开发和后端开发进行集成测试,确保系统的功能正常工作。进行系统的整体测试和优化,解决潜在的Bug和性能问题。
-
发布和部署:将开发好的系统部署到服务器或云平台上,确保系统能够正常访问和使用。进行服务器的配置和性能优化,确保系统的稳定和可靠。
-
迭代和维护:发布后,根据用户反馈和市场需求,对系统进行迭代和升级。监测系统的性能和稳定性,及时进行维护和修复。
以上是一个Web前端管理系统项目的开发过程的主要步骤,根据具体项目的特点和需求,可以进行调整和修改。在开发过程中,要与团队成员进行良好的沟通合作,注重代码质量和系统的性能,确保项目的成功完成。
1年前 -
-
构建一个Web前端管理系统项目可以按照以下步骤进行:
1.项目需求分析和规划
首先,了解用户的需求,并确定项目的规模和功能。这包括确定要开发的模块,如用户管理、角色管理、权限管理、数据管理等。还应该考虑到系统的易用性、安全性、性能等方面的需求。2.项目技术选型
选择适合项目的技术栈,如前端框架、后端语言和数据库等。常见的前端框架有Vue.js、React和Angular等,而后端语言可以是Java、Python和PHP等。在选择技术栈时,需要考虑到开发团队的熟悉程度、项目的要求和预算等因素。3.设计系统架构和数据库设计
根据项目需求,设计系统的架构和数据库结构。系统架构包括前端页面的布局和组件划分,以及与后端的接口设计。数据库设计则需要定义数据表的字段、关系和约束。4.前端开发
前端开发是构建Web前端管理系统的核心部分。可以根据需求先设计页面的UI界面和交互效果,然后利用所选的前端框架进行开发。可以使用HTML、CSS和JavaScript等技术来创建页面,并将页面与后端接口进行对接。5.后端开发
后端开发主要负责处理前端发送的请求,完成业务逻辑的处理,并与数据库进行交互。根据所选的后端语言和框架进行开发,可以使用框架提供的数据库交互、路由控制和身份认证等功能。同时,还需要编写API文档,方便前端开发人员调用后端接口。6.测试和部署
开发完成后,对系统进行测试和调试,确保功能的正常运行。可以进行单元测试、接口测试和整体功能测试等。测试通过后,将系统部署到服务器上,可以使用Nginx等服务器软件进行部署和配置。除此之外,还可以考虑其他的开发流程和工具,如版本控制、持续集成和自动化部署等,以提高开发效率和质量。另外,还应该关注用户的反馈和需求,及时进行系统的迭代和更新。
1年前 -
一、项目需求分析
1.1 确定项目目标:明确前端管理系统的功能和使用场景,明确项目的整体目标和要实现的效果。
1.2 收集需求:与相关人员(产品经理、业务人员等)进行沟通,了解需求,并进行详细的需求收集和分析。二、技术选型
2.1 选择合适的开发语言和框架:根据项目需求和开发团队的技术背景,选择合适的前端开发语言(如HTML、CSS、JavaScript)以及框架(如React、Vue等)。
2.2 选择合适的前端工具:根据项目需求和开发团队的工作习惯,选择合适的前端开发工具(如VS Code、Sublime Text等)。三、项目架构设计
3.1 设计系统结构:根据项目需求和功能模块,设计整体的系统结构和页面布局。
3.2 设计数据库结构:根据需求设计数据库表结构,确定数据的存储方式和关系。
3.3 设计前端界面:根据需求和系统结构,设计前端界面,包括页面布局、样式、交互等。四、前端开发
4.1 开发页面布局:根据设计稿或者界面设计,使用HTML和CSS搭建页面布局,实现界面的静态效果。
4.2 开发前端交互:使用JavaScript实现用户界面的交互效果,如表单验证、按钮点击等。
4.3 调用后端API:根据后端提供的API文档,使用Ajax等技术,通过请求和接收数据实现页面的动态效果。五、前后台交互
5.1 接口文档设计:根据前后端的约定,编写接口文档,明确接口的参数、返回值以及调用方式。
5.2 实现接口请求:根据接口文档,使用Axios等工具,向后端发送请求,并获取返回的数据。
5.3 处理接口返回数据:根据后端返回的数据,对页面进行更新、渲染或跳转。六、系统测试与优化
6.1 单元测试:对系统的各个模块和功能进行单元测试,确保每个模块的功能正常。
6.2 系统测试:对整个系统进行回归测试,测试系统在各种场景下的表现。
6.3 性能优化:对系统进行性能优化,包括减少HTTP请求数量、压缩资源文件、使用缓存等方面。
6.4 安全测试:进行系统的安全性测试,包括XSS攻击、CSRF攻击等。七、上线与维护
7.1 上线准备:将系统部署到服务器上,配置相应的环境,如数据库、服务器环境等。
7.2 上线测试:对上线的系统进行测试,确保部署后的系统正常运行。
7.3 系统运维:定期对系统进行维护和更新,修复bug,并根据用户反馈进行功能优化和改进。以上是一个较为完整的web前端管理系统项目的开发流程,具体的操作细节还需根据实际情况进行调整。在开发过程中,要注重项目的需求分析和设计、代码的质量和规范、系统的稳定性和安全性等方面。同时,与团队成员的紧密合作和沟通也是项目开发中必不可少的一环。
1年前